Solution for (4t-3)=2(t+1)+2 equation:


Simplifying
(4t + -3) = 2(t + 1) + 2

Reorder the terms:
(-3 + 4t) = 2(t + 1) + 2

Remove parenthesis around (-3 + 4t)
-3 + 4t = 2(t + 1) + 2

Reorder the terms:
-3 + 4t = 2(1 + t) + 2
-3 + 4t = (1 * 2 + t * 2) + 2
-3 + 4t = (2 + 2t) + 2

Reorder the terms:
-3 + 4t = 2 + 2 + 2t

Combine like terms: 2 + 2 = 4
-3 + 4t = 4 + 2t

Solving
-3 + 4t = 4 + 2t

Solving for variable 't'.

Move all terms containing t to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-2t' to each side of the equation.
-3 + 4t + -2t = 4 + 2t + -2t

Combine like terms: 4t + -2t = 2t
-3 + 2t = 4 + 2t + -2t

Combine like terms: 2t + -2t = 0
-3 + 2t = 4 + 0
-3 + 2t = 4

Add '3' to each side of the equation.
-3 + 3 + 2t = 4 + 3

Combine like terms: -3 + 3 = 0
0 + 2t = 4 + 3
2t = 4 + 3

Combine like terms: 4 + 3 = 7
2t = 7

Divide each side by '2'.
t = 3.5

Simplifying
t = 3.5
